Karwendel Nature Information Centre: discovering nature at dizzying heights

When you are 2,244 metres above sea level, there is more to see than just mountain peaks and edelweiss. From the outside, the Karwendel Nature Information Centre resembles a giant wooden telescope, gazing out towards the Isartal valley. But inside it contains Germany's highest environmental exhibition. From Mittenwald station, it's a ten-minute walk to the Karwendelbahn cable car, which takes to straight to the top to the Nature Information Centre.
